Re: [Galette-devel] codage plugins sous galette 0.7.3

2013-01-27 Par sujet Johan Cwiklinski
Le 27/01/2013 09:45, André Lefranc a écrit :
> C'est l'appel à une class avec WEB_ROOT  qui ne fonctionnait pas.
> J'ai supprimé cet appel (je ne sais plus pourquoi, je l'avais intégré)
> et cela roule !!!

Globalement, tous les appels à WEB_ROOT doivent être supprimés ; cette
constante n'existe plus depuis quelque temps déjà.

Dans les plugins, ce n'était _vraiment_ pas une bonne idée de toutes
façons (je n'ai plus l'exemple en tête, mais ça m'avait posé des
problèmes)...

++
-- 
Johan



signature.asc
Description: OpenPGP digital signature
___
Galette-devel mailing list
Galette-devel@gna.org
https://mail.gna.org/listinfo/galette-devel


Re: [Galette-devel] codage plugins sous galette 0.7.3

2013-01-27 Par sujet André Lefranc

Le 27/01/13 09:41, Johan Cwiklinski a écrit :

Le 27/01/2013 00:56, André Lefranc a écrit :

  je suppose qu'une bibliothèque a été changée ?

Non. Soit l'erreur existait déjà ; soit c'est la configuration du
serveur qui a changé. À voir avec l'hébergeur.


Mon  problème  est  résolu : merci Johan

C'est l'appel à une class avec WEB_ROOT  qui ne fonctionnait pas.
J'ai supprimé cet appel (je ne sais plus pourquoi, je l'avais intégré)
et cela roule !!!

Mon plugin  est utile pour les associations qui gèrent des attestations 
fiscales


Bonne journée


++


___
Galette-devel mailing list
Galette-devel@gna.org
https://mail.gna.org/listinfo/galette-devel


___
Galette-devel mailing list
Galette-devel@gna.org
https://mail.gna.org/listinfo/galette-devel


Re: [Galette-devel] codage plugins sous galette 0.7.3

2013-01-27 Par sujet Johan Cwiklinski
Le 27/01/2013 00:56, André Lefranc a écrit :
>  je suppose qu'une bibliothèque a été changée ?

Non. Soit l'erreur existait déjà ; soit c'est la configuration du
serveur qui a changé. À voir avec l'hébergeur.

++
-- 
Johan



signature.asc
Description: OpenPGP digital signature
___
Galette-devel mailing list
Galette-devel@gna.org
https://mail.gna.org/listinfo/galette-devel


Re: [Galette-devel] codage plugins sous galette 0.7.3

2013-01-26 Par sujet André Lefranc

Le 27/01/13 00:42, Johan Cwiklinski a écrit :

Salut,

Le 27/01/2013 00:26, André Lefranc a écrit :

J'ai essayé en modifiant les lignes  avec $_GET  mais cela ne marche pas

Heu, pour moi ; c'est du chinois...

Puis bon, il s'agit d'un simple bout de code ; je ne vois pas comment tu
peux savoir si le problème vient de là (et si tu le sais, moi je le sais
pas).

Vas voir les logs php/galette, tu y trouveras l'erreur.


Merci Johan  :
Je n'ai pas tous les réflexes :
le log dit ceci :

80.67.160.69 - 2013-01-26 13:59:44 - 4 - PHP Warning: putenv(): Safe 
Mode warning: Cannot set environment variable 'LANG' - it's not in the 
allowed list in /var/alternc/html/m/molene/www/

...  /galette/includes/i18n.inc.php on line 54

80.67.160.69 - 2013-01-26 13:59:44 - 4 - PHP Warning: putenv(): Safe 
Mode warning: Cannot set environment variable 'LANGUAGE' - it's not in 
the allowed list in /var/alternc/html/m/molene/www/...

...  /galette/includes/i18n.inc.php on line 55

80.67.160.69 - 2013-01-26 13:59:44 - 4 - PHP Warning: putenv(): Safe 
Mode warning: Cannot set environment variable 'LC_ALL' - it's not in the 
allowed list in /var/alternc/html/m/molene/www/..

...  galette/includes/i18n.inc.php on line 56

 je suppose qu'une bibliothèque a été changée ?



++


___
Galette-devel mailing list
Galette-devel@gna.org
https://mail.gna.org/listinfo/galette-devel


___
Galette-devel mailing list
Galette-devel@gna.org
https://mail.gna.org/listinfo/galette-devel


Re: [Galette-devel] codage plugins sous galette 0.7.3

2013-01-26 Par sujet Johan Cwiklinski
Salut,

Le 27/01/2013 00:26, André Lefranc a écrit :
> J'ai essayé en modifiant les lignes  avec $_GET  mais cela ne marche pas

Heu, pour moi ; c'est du chinois...

Puis bon, il s'agit d'un simple bout de code ; je ne vois pas comment tu
peux savoir si le problème vient de là (et si tu le sais, moi je le sais
pas).

Vas voir les logs php/galette, tu y trouveras l'erreur.

++
-- 
Johan



signature.asc
Description: OpenPGP digital signature
___
Galette-devel mailing list
Galette-devel@gna.org
https://mail.gna.org/listinfo/galette-devel


Re: [Galette-devel] codage plugins sous galette 0.7.3

2013-01-26 Par sujet André Lefranc

Le 26/01/13 17:50, Johan Cwiklinski a écrit :

Salut,

Le 26/01/2013 17:05, André Lefranc a écrit :

Depuis la version 0.7.3, ils ne fonctionnent plus :
[...]
  quelles sont les modifications à faire pour rétablir le fonctionnement
de ces plugins ?


Il y a eu des changements qui impactent les plugins en 0.7.3...

 Notamment un :
define('GALETTE_BASE_PATH', '../../');



J'ai répondu à cette question il y a quelques jours :
https://mail.gna.org/public/galette-devel/2013-01/msg2.html

Les modifications se limitent à très peu de choses :)
 je pense que j'ai une autres source de problèmes :
 car aucun document n'est produit :

require_once 'classes/pdf.attestation.class.php';
include 'conversion_litterale.php';

$date_debut = '2012-01-02';
$date_fin = '2012-12-29';

//$pdf->pdf->SetProtection(array('print'), 'my_password');

if ( !$login->isLogged() or $login->isAdmin()
&& (!isset($_GET[Adherent::PK]) || trim($_GET[Adherent::PK]) == '')
) {
//If not logged, or if admin without a member id ; print en empty card
$adh = null;
} else if ( $login->isAdmin() && isset($_GET[Galette\Entity\Adherent::PK]) ) {
//If admin with a member id
$adh = new Adherent((int)$_GET[Galette\Entity\Adherent::PK]);
} else if ( $login->isLogged() ) {
//If user logged in
$adh = new Adherent((int)$login->id);
}

J'ai essayé en modifiant les lignes  avec $_GET  mais cela ne marche pas

qui peut encore m'aider ?

 ++




___
Galette-devel mailing list
Galette-devel@gna.org
https://mail.gna.org/listinfo/galette-devel


___
Galette-devel mailing list
Galette-devel@gna.org
https://mail.gna.org/listinfo/galette-devel


Re: [Galette-devel] codage plugins sous galette 0.7.3

2013-01-26 Par sujet Johan Cwiklinski
Salut,

Le 26/01/2013 17:05, André Lefranc a écrit :
> Depuis la version 0.7.3, ils ne fonctionnent plus :
> [...]
>  quelles sont les modifications à faire pour rétablir le fonctionnement
> de ces plugins ?

J'ai répondu à cette question il y a quelques jours :
https://mail.gna.org/public/galette-devel/2013-01/msg2.html

Les modifications se limitent à très peu de choses :)

++
-- 
Johan



signature.asc
Description: OpenPGP digital signature
___
Galette-devel mailing list
Galette-devel@gna.org
https://mail.gna.org/listinfo/galette-devel


[Galette-devel] codage plugins sous galette 0.7.3

2013-01-26 Par sujet André Lefranc

Bonjour,
Mes plugins fonctionnaient sous O.7.2, avec production de documents 
personnalisés,

en format Pdf.

Depuis la version 0.7.3, ils ne fonctionnent plus :
Ils sont indispensabes pour me permettre de passer en nouvelle version :
(attestation fiscales et données pour permettre virement)

 quelles sont les modifications à faire pour rétablir le fonctionnement 
de ces plugins ?


je suppose qu'il s'agit des premières lignes :



/use Galette\IO\Pdf as Pdf;//
//use Galette\Entity\Adherent as Adherent;//
//
//$base_path = '../../';//
//require_once $base_path . 'includes/galette.inc.php';//
//require_once 'classes/pdf.virement.class.php';/


 j'ai créé cette classe pour faciliter mon suivi lors du passage vers 
la version 0.7.2


Qui peut m'aider ?



___
Galette-devel mailing list
Galette-devel@gna.org
https://mail.gna.org/listinfo/galette-devel